I added the line to loader.conf, and disabled moused, and the synaptics driver gets detected and used. It actually helps with the jitteriness of the mouse quite a bit. There's no virtual scrolling though. Has that been added to the driver yet, or am I missing some config items? > On Jun 16, 2014, at 11:06 AM, Anthony Jenkins <[email protected]> wrote: > > Ahhh...sorry, I still haven't looked at this at all.
